Understanding Sports Betting in Brazil

Overview of Legal Framework

The landscape of sports betting in Brazil is evolving rapidly, especially in light of recent legislative changes. Historically, the Brazilian gambling scene has been tightly regulated. With the enactment of new laws, the country is moving towards a more open market, allowing licensed operators to offer online betting services. The Brazilian government is introducing a regulated framework that includes both land-based and online betting, designed to curb illegal operations and boost tax revenues for public health, education, and sports. As of now, horse racing and sports betting are legal, while other forms of gambling, such as online casinos, are still under strict regulations. It is anticipated that the licensing regime will include robust measures for consumer protection, AML (Anti-Money Laundering), and responsible gaming commitments.

Types of Sports Bets Available

In Brazil, punters have an exciting array of betting options at their disposal. The two primary types of sports bets are traditional and live (in-play) bets. Traditional bets allow gamblers to place their wagers before a sporting event begins, while live betting enables participants to place wagers during the event, capitalizing on the ever-changing dynamics of the game. Common types of bets include:

  • Moneyline Bets: A straightforward bet on which team will win.
  • Point Spread Bets: Betting on a team’s margin of victory.
  • Over/Under Bets: A wager on the combined score of both teams.
  • Proposition Bets: Bets on specific events within a game, such as the first team to score.
  • Parlay Bets: Combining multiple bets into one for a higher payout potential.

Understanding the intricacies of these different types of bets can significantly enhance the betting experience and improve the odds of success.

Understanding Odds and Betting Lines

Understanding odds and betting lines is crucial for making informed decisions. Here’s a breakdown of how they work:

  • Decimal Odds: Commonly used in Brazil, these odds are straightforward, where your total payout equals the stake multiplied by the odds.
  • Fractional Odds: Often seen in traditional betting, these show the profit relative to the stake, indicating how much you can win on a bet.
  • American Odds: Represented as either positive or negative values, these indicate how much you need to bet or how much you’ll win on a $100 wager.

The Future of Sports Betting in Brazil

Upcoming Regulatory Changes

The future of sports betting in Brazil is poised for significant shifts, particularly with upcoming regulatory changes anticipated to provide clarity and security for operators and punters alike. Legislative measures are being developed to align with international standards, ensuring that consumer protection and fair play are prioritized. This includes stricter licensing requirements and more comprehensive measures to combat illegal gambling operations.
